Which word is more common?

Confidence is more commonly used than assertiveness in everyday language. Confidence is a versatile term that can be applied to various contexts, while assertiveness is more specific and often used in discussions about communication and personal boundaries.

Whatโ€™s the difference in the tone of formality between assertiveness and confidence?

Both assertiveness and confidence can be used in both formal and informal contexts. However, assertiveness may be more commonly associated with professional or assertive communication training, while confidence is a broader term that can be used in a wide range of situations.
